Apple is looking to integrate Apple Intelligence into Siri across all Apple devices to make it more seamless and intelligent
Requirements
- Strong programming skills in one or more compiled languages (Swift, C++ or Objective-C)
- Demonstrated ability to learn new technologies and development environments quickly
- Solid understanding of computer science fundamentals: data structures, algorithms, system design, concurrency, and object-oriented programming
- Proficient programming skills in Python
- Experience with iOS development or building apps for Apple platforms (personal, academic, or professional)
- Exposure working with coding agents
- Familiarity with LLMs and Model Context Protocol (MCP)
Responsibilities
- You'll design, develop, test, and maintain the core runtime platform that powers Siri
- Apply LLM to enhance Siri’s intelligence and collaborate with cross-functional teams to build and integrate new Siri experiences for upcoming products
- Create software that meets Apple's high standards of quality and performance
- Build tooling and infrastructure to increase productivity of processes
Other
- Excellent communication skills and collaborative skills with cross functional teams
- M.S./B.S. degree in Computer Science, Machine Learning, or a related technical field, or equivalent practical experience
- Self-starter with a proven ability to handle multiple projects with strict deadlines
- Comprehensive medical and dental coverage, retirement benefits, a range of discounted products and free services
- Reimbursement for certain educational expenses - including tuition